One of the first things travelers need is efficient ticket purchase and collection. At Haywards Heath, the station ensures a smooth ticketing experience. The ticket office operates from early morning till late evening throughout the week. Alternatively, ticket machines are available for quick purchases to help you get on your way, and they even acc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is designed with accessibility in mind, offering step-free access throughout, making it a Category A station. For those who require additional support, assistance is available from station staff, ensuring that everyone can make their way smoothly onto the trains. While accessible toilets are unfortunately not available, the station is equipped with induction loops and ramps for train access to help those who might need them.
For tech-savvy travelers, however, it should be noted that public Wi-Fi is currently unavailable at the station. But if you’re planning to make a quick stop and need cash on the go, ATMs can be found at the station to accommodate your needs. The convenience extends to cycle storage too, with over 300 spaces available for bike enthusiasts.
Getting to and from Haywards Heath station is a breeze. The station features a well-maintained taxi rank right outside its main entrance, simplifying the journey to your next destination. For those preferring buses, detailed travel information can be easily found within the station premises to plan your onward journey effectively.
Though there are no onsite shops or refreshment facilities, the town center is just a short walk away, where you can find plenty of options to grab a bite or shop around.

Tring station is equipped with multiple ticket vending machines, including accessible options found by the short stay car park. The ticket office is open across various hours throughout the week, from 6 AM until 7 PM on weekdays—perfect for those needing that early morning or late evening service. An induction loop is available for enhanced communication, and customer information is up-to-date through handy departure screens and announcements.
Step-free access is a key component of Tring station, making it classified under category A for ease of mobility. Assistance is readily available both at the ticket office and on the platforms when staff are present, ensuring all travelers can move with confidence. Although there are no restrooms or waiting rooms, a sufficient seating area is provided, ideal for short-wait intervals.
Accessibility is paramount at Tring, with features like ramps for train access and a designated mobility set down/pick-up point, ensuring everyone can travel comfortably. While there aren't any accessible toilets or staffed wheelchairs, the train station's step-free access and 24/7 available parking help accommodate an inclusive travel experience.
When considering onward journeys, Tring station is perfectly positioned, offering excellent transport links. Taxi services are accessible through a taxi free phone, making it easy to organize your travel plans. Should your journey require rail replacement, buses are conveniently located just outside the front of the station. For those seeking additional planning resources, printable bus schedules and routes are readily available online.

While Wi-Fi isn’t available in the station, travelers can make use of pay phones provided on-site. For cyclists, Tring station offers storage for up to 120 bicycles. Unfortunately, ATM services, shops, and cycle hire facilities are not currently available.
